    I have a KT3 Ultra ARU too, and I understand that if you use the onboard Bluetooth connection you must not use the USB connection under the blue sticker at the same time.
    I think it's because the onboard Bluetooth connection and the USB connection under the sticker use the same adress (IRQ). So as long as you have no Bluetooth, like me, you can use the 4 USB connections. If you use Bluetooth connection on board, do not use the USB connection under the sticker (the left one seen from backside of your PC).
    If you use an external Bluetooth it's not a problem with your 4 USB connections.

    you would have more chance of it booting at 166
    than 151 as the divider kicks in at 152
    at 166 fsb your video and pci slots are at the correct speed
